a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orPrasanth Pallamreddy <[email protected]>2014-03-23 22:18:18 -0700
committerPrasanth Pallamreddy <[email protected]>2014-03-23 22:18:18 -0700
commitf2bcacf736cd487b335f50736de74f6c37b22ef4 (patch)
treee4136d34fd90489f20cce8045e92638df9d60e86
parent614b124cac36f792eb934047231a3ac1ad2f13eb (diff)
Issue #23 - Support bundle artifact type
-rwxr-xr-xenforcer-rule/src/main/java/org/semver/enforcer/AbstractEnforcerRule.java7
1 files changed, 5 insertions, 2 deletions
diff --git a/enforcer-rule/src/main/java/org/semver/enforcer/AbstractEnforcerRule.java b/enforcer-rule/src/main/java/org/semver/enforcer/AbstractEnforcerRule.java
index dd10c44..91356e9 100755
--- a/enforcer-rule/src/main/java/org/semver/enforcer/AbstractEnforcerRule.java
+++ b/enforcer-rule/src/main/java/org/semver/enforcer/AbstractEnforcerRule.java
@@ -50,6 +50,7 @@ import org.semver.Version;
public abstract class AbstractEnforcerRule implements EnforcerRule {
private static final String JAR_ARTIFACT_TYPE = "jar";
+ private static final String BUNDLE_ARTIFACT_TYPE = "bundle";
/**
* Version number of artifact to be checked.
@@ -95,8 +96,10 @@ public abstract class AbstractEnforcerRule implements EnforcerRule {
throw new EnforcerRuleException("Failed to access ${project} variable", e);
}
final String type = project.getArtifact().getType();
- if (!AbstractEnforcerRule.JAR_ARTIFACT_TYPE.equals(type)) {
- helper.getLog().debug("Skipping non "+AbstractEnforcerRule.JAR_ARTIFACT_TYPE+" artifact.");
+ if (!AbstractEnforcerRule.JAR_ARTIFACT_TYPE.equals(type) &&
+ !AbstractEnforcerRule.BUNDLE_ARTIFACT_TYPE.equals(type)) {
+ helper.getLog().debug("Skipping non "+AbstractEnforcerRule.JAR_ARTIFACT_TYPE+
+ " or " + BUNDLE_ARTIFACT_TYPE + " artifact.");
return;
}